Confluent

Senior Software Engineer

Confluent1 weeks ago
Location

*Job Posting Only: USA1

Workplace

Remote

Type

Full Time

Salary

USD 182,100 – 245,800

Level

Senior

Role

Senior Software Engineer

Posted

Jun 3, 2026

Full TimeRemoteSenior

The role

Summary

Confluent is seeking a Senior Software Engineer to work on the Tableflow project, focusing on developing next-generation storage solutions for their Kora platform. The role involves designing innovative storage engine strategies, building multi-tenant infrastructure, and collaborating across teams to advance data streaming technology.

What you'll do

Storage Engine Development: Design and implement innovative strategies for table schematization, materialization, and compaction at massive scale, focusing on advanced storage solutions for the Tableflow project.
Platform Engineering: Build and maintain multi-tenant, highly available infrastructure powering background computational tasks for Kora's long-term storage, ensuring scalability, reliability, and resilience.
Cross-Functional Collaboration: Work closely with product management, design, and other engineering teams to ensure seamless integration of storage features and infrastructure across the organization.

What we look for

Technical

Cloud PlatformsExperience with public cloud platforms such as AWS, Azure, or GCP
Distributed SystemsStrong understanding of distributed storage systems and infrastructure challenges
Open Source TechnologiesFamiliarity with Apache Kafka, Apache Iceberg, and Apache Flink

Education

Academic BackgroundBS, MS, or PhD in Computer Science or related technical field

Experience

Communication SkillsExcellent communication and collaboration abilities, with capacity to influence stakeholders at all levels

Skills

Required skills

Distributed SystemsDeep understanding of complex distributed storage system design and implementation
Infrastructure EngineeringAbility to build scalable, reliable multi-tenant computational infrastructure

Nice to have

Open Source ContributionPrevious contributions to Apache Kafka, Apache Iceberg, or Apache Flink ecosystems
Cloud Native TechnologiesExperience with cloud-native infrastructure and data streaming platforms

Compensation & benefits

Salary

USD 182,100 – 245,800 (annual)

Stock options

Available

Benefits

Equal Opportunity Workplace

Commitment to diversity, inclusion, and providing equal opportunities regardless of background

Flexible Work Arrangement

Remote work options with potential for cross-timezone collaboration

Equity Compensation

Stock options or equity compensation included in total package


Interview process

  1. 1
    Initial Screening Phone or video call with recruiting team to assess background and initial fit
  2. 2
    Technical Interview In-depth technical discussion focusing on distributed systems, storage architecture, and problem-solving skills
  3. 3
    System Design Challenge Evaluate candidate's ability to design scalable, resilient infrastructure solutions
  4. 4
    Team Fit Interview Meetings with potential team members to assess collaboration and communication skills

Apply for this position

You'll be redirected to the company's application page